What is DeFAI?
DeFAI, or Decentralized Finance Artificial Intelligence, is nothing more than the combination and integration of decentralized finance (DeFi) with artificial intelligence (AI).
The term "DeFAI" was first introduced by Daniele Sesta, a notable figure in the crypto community known for his work on DeFi projects like Wonderland, Popsicle Finance, and Abracadabra Money. He coined 'DeFAI' in his article discussing the dawn of AI-powered decentralized autonomous organizations, where the ‘autonomous’ part of the DAO could be filled in with our AI run code.

The initial surge that kicked off the AI craze within crypto came with some notable projects like Goatseus Maximus, which originated from Andy Ayrey's Truth Terminal experiment (also the ideator of Fartcoin). Which saw a meme AI trend expand rapidly, featuring a plethora of AI agents and frameworks achieving a peak market cap after its decline and round trip in price.
Despite this impressive introduction, the true potential of AI in blockchain was not fully realized until the advent of DeFAI.

What Sets DeFAI Apart from Other AI and Blockchain Integrations?
DeFAI distinguishes itself by offering tangible blockchain integration, moving beyond the basic functionalities of early AI agents. These agents, which were mostly focused on automating content creation for social media, lacked significant on-chain activity.
On the other hand, it involves a different approach where AI is leveraged to develop tools that genuinely enhance and automate on-chain operations, such as:
- Automated Trading/Farming: AI algorithms analyze market patterns and execute trades efficiently.
- Risk Management: AI systems identify and mitigate potential financial risks.
- Yield Optimization: AI-driven strategies aim to maximize returns across various protocols.
- Fraud Prevention: Advanced systems work to safeguard user assets against fraudulent activities.
- Chart Analysis: AI automates the analysis of charts, indicators, and patterns, providing actionable insights.
- Project Updates and Summaries: AI fetches, analyzes, and summarizes crucial information from crypto projects.

MCP
MCP, or Model Context Protocol, eliminated the need for developers to manually integrate APIs when creating an AI. Before MCP, devs had to explicitly outline and hardcode API access. With MCP, any AI following the protocol can directly access an application's functionality via the AI simply requesting access.

DeFAI More than Hype?
The crypto community is divided on whether DeFAI is just hype or a genuinely useful innovation. While some projects boast sleek interfaces and promise high utility, the real-world application and necessity of these platforms can be questioned.
Many DeFAI projects present themselves as revolutionary, but how many of them provide tangible benefits that cannot be found in traditional DeFi platforms? The key here is determining whether the AI integration in DeFAI projects genuinely simplifies processes or if it's just adding an unnecessary layer of complexity disguised as innovation.
The Future of DeFAI
While DeFAI presents a futuristic vision of finance, its success hinges on its ability to offer tangible improvements over existing DeFi platforms.
What is important is that it has benefits in the way we do business with these protocols and they do for us. It could indeed increase the accessibility for non-technical users to automate the execution of these strategies offered by many protocols that integrate AI in their workings.
Looking ahead, we can expect more sophisticated AI tools to emerge, offering both challenges and solutions, and their success will depend on their ability to be capable of handling complex on-chain tasks with minimal human oversight.
DeFi AI has the potential to significantly lower the barriers to entry for people looking to get involved in crypto and DeFi. The growing number of chains, protocols, and liquidity systems can be daunting for newcomers. AI assistance and automation can abstract away much of this complexity, making it easier for average users to safely and effectively participate.
DeFAI on Bitcoin...
The integration of artificial intelligence with Bitcoin's blockchain offers also intriguing possibilities. As it could work both ways, AI has the potential to enhance security on the Bitcoin network, through verifying identities and information or securing documents via encryption.

But it can optimize peripheral aspects of mining operations, reducing costs and downtime for miners. Beyond optimizations, AI may enable autonomous trading agents to execute transactions and analyze market data to inform trades.
